情态动词should、must、can、need、have to与had better   情态动词本身有词义,表示说话人对有关行为或事物的态度和看法,不能独立作谓语,一般和实义动词原形一起构成谓语,并放在实义动词原形前。 情态动词及其用法 例句 should意为“应当”,表示建议或劝告,有“劝说”或“敦促”的含义,否定式为should not/shouldn't。 You should talk to your parents about your feelings. 你应该和你父母谈谈你的感受。 had better意为“最好”,表示劝告或建议,一般不用于疑问句中,否定式为had better not。 You had better not tell Oliver. 你最好不要告诉Oliver。 (1) can表示请求许可或给予许可, could也有此用法,语气比can更委婉; 否定式cannot/can't表示“不能,不可以”,语气弱于must not。 (2) can/could均可表示能力, could是can的过去式,可以表示过去的能力。 一般情况下,以can开头的一般疑问句,肯定回答用can, 否定回答用can't。 —Can I borrow your bike? 我可以借你的自行车吗? —Yes, you can. 是的,你可以。 —No, you can't. 不,你不可以。 Can you type?你会打字吗? When I was young, I could climb any tree in the forest. 年轻时,森林里的树我都能爬上去。 must表示“必须” 否定式must not/mustn't表示“不应该,禁止”,是强有力的劝告或命令。 由must引导的一般疑问句,肯定回答用must,否定回答用needn't/don't have to,表示“不必,没有必要”。 All passengers must wear seat belts. 所有乘客都必须系安全带。 Cars must not park in front of the entrance. 车辆不得停在入口处。 —Must I clean the room this afternoon? 我必须今天下午打扫房间吗? —Yes, you must. 是的,你必须。 —No, you needn't/don't have to. 不,你不必。 have to表示“不得不,必须”,否定式do not/don't have to表示“不必,没有必要”(=needn't)。 You don't have to worry about them any more. 你再也不必为他们发愁了。 need表示“必须,需要”,一般用于否定句和疑问句中,否定式need not/needn't表示“不需要,不必”。一般情况下,以need开头的一般疑问句,肯定回答用must,否定回答用needn't。 —Need I put the umbrella outside? 我需要把雨伞放在外面吗? —Yes, you must. 是的,你必须(放在外面)。 —No, you needn't. 不,你不必(放在外面)。 shall用于第一、三人称的疑问句中时,表示征求对方的意见或提出建议。 Shall I answer the telephone for you? 要我替你接电话吗? Xi’an is a city always remaking 10 (it) and looking forward, all the while keeping the best of the past. 表示“可能性与推测”的常用情态动词 一. 情态动词may/might表示可能性 may/might表示将要发生或正在发生的可能性。此时,might不是may的过去式,它所表示的可能性比may所表示的可能性(现在或将来的可能性)小一些。may不用于表示是否可能的疑问句。 He may not know the answer.他可能不知道答案。 Mike might phone. If he does, could you ask him to ring later? Mike或许会打电话。如果他打电话,你能否让他晚点再打过来? 注意 表示“可能”的常见词possible、possibly、probably、maybe等 单词 例句 possible Is it possible to get tickets for the game? 有没有可能弄到比赛的门票? possibly/ probably It will possibly/probably take us about a week to complete the task. 我们可能需要一星期左右来完成这项任务。 maybe The chair will cost one hundred, maybe two hundred yuan. 这把椅子要花费一百元,或许两百元。 二. 情态动词must、can、could表示推测 单词 用法 must 表示有把握的推测,意为“一定,肯定”,通常只用于肯定句。 can 可表示对现在或将来的推测,意为“会,可能”,往往用于否定句和疑问句。 用于疑问句时,can比could表示的可能性要大;用于否定句时,can't意为“不可能”,表示有把握的否定推测。 could 可表示对现在或将来的推测,意为“会,可能”,可用于肯定句、否定句和疑问句。 You must be tired after the long work. 长时间工作之后,你一定累了。 Can/Could this be true? 这有可能是真的吗? It can't be David because he has gone to Beijing. 不可能是David,因为他去北京了。 一.单项选择 1.—Have you decided where to go for your winter vacation? —Not yet, but we ________ go to Harbin.
